"Day of Liberation" for Trump: retaliatory tariffs on all countries of at least 10%

Donald Trump has just concluded a press conference where he detailed his tariff strategy in honor of the "Day of Emancipation." According to him, the administration has analyzed all existing tariffs against the U.S. and now plans to introduce mirror tariffs at 50% of those rates.

The new measures will affect absolutely all imported goods, regardless of industry and initial conditions. The minimum tariff level for all countries will be 10%. Following this announcement, the markets reacted negatively: stocks and cryptocurrencies fell.

According to Trump, the essence of the "Day of Liberation" lies in the system of retaliatory tariffs. The administration calculates how many tariffs a particular country has imposed against American goods, including areas such as agriculture. The U.S. then charges either 50 percent of that amount or 10 percent. To explain the strategy, Trump demonstrated a table with calculations.
